立即下载 立即下载 立即下载
当前位置:首页>专题

如何在谷歌浏览器中使用API

2024-12-25 12:30 chrome浏览器官网

在当今数字化时代,API(应用程序编程接口)已成为软件开发和网页设计的核心工具。通过API,开发者能够连接不同的应用和服务,从而创建丰富的用户体验。如果你想在谷歌浏览器中使用API,以下是一些关键步骤和技巧,帮助你顺利进行。

首先,了解API的基本概念是使用它们的第一步。API是定义不同软件组件之间交互的规范和工具,它可以让开发者在应用程序中访问某些功能或数据。在浏览器环境中,最常见的API是Web API,如Fetch API、DOM API和Canvas API等。

接下来,我们需要认识到如何在谷歌浏览器中使用这些API。这里以Fetch API为例,介绍如何通过JavaScript发起HTTP请求并处理响应。

1. **使用Fetch API发起请求**

Fetch API提供了一种简便的方式来进行网络请求。使用方法如下:

```javascript

fetch('https://api.example.com/data')

.then(response => {

if (!response.ok) {

throw new Error('Network response was not ok');

}

return response.json();

})

.then(data => {

console.log(data);

})

.catch(error => {

console.error('There has been a problem with your fetch operation:', error);

});

```

在这个示例中,`fetch`函数接受一个URL作为参数,并返回一个Promise对象。当请求完成后,它会解析响应,并将数据以JSON格式返回。注意,如果请求失败,我们可以通过`.catch`捕获错误并进行处理。

2. **处理跨域请求**

在开发过程中,跨域请求可能会遇到一些问题。由于同源策略的定义,如果你向不同的域发送请求,浏览器会阻止这种操作。为了解决这个问题,可以使用CORS(跨域资源共享)机制。确保API的服务器设置了适当的CORS头部,以允许来自你的网页的请求。

3. **使用开发者工具调试**

谷歌浏览器提供了强大的开发者工具,可以帮助你调试API请求。在浏览器中右击,选择“检查”或按F12打开开发者工具。在“网络”标签中,你可以看到发出的所有网络请求。点击请求可以查看详细信息,包括请求头、响应头和返回数据等。这对于调试API调用至关重要。

4. **处理错误和异常**

在使用API时,处理潜在的错误和异常是非常重要的。确保使用`try...catch`语句来捕获可能的错误,并根据错误类型提供相应的用户反馈。这不仅能提升用户体验,还能帮助你在开发过程中更快地解决问题。

5. **学习和使用第三方API**

许多平台和服务(如Twitter、Google Maps、Weather API等)提供了开放的API,允许开发者访问其数据和功能。你可以通过阅读相应的文档来学习如何集成这些API。在使用第三方API时,确保遵循其使用指南,并注意相关的速率限制与认证要求。

总结而言,掌握在谷歌浏览器中使用API的技巧将极大地丰富你的开发能力。从基本的Fetch请求到调试网络操作,这些技能将帮助你构建更强大和互动性更高的网页应用。随着对API理解的加深,你将能够在更广泛的项目中有效应用它们,创造出更好的用户体验。

相关推荐
 谷歌浏览器中的在线会议解决方案

谷歌浏览器中的在线会议解决方案

随着远程工作和在线交流的普及,在线会议已成为各类组织和企业沟通的重要工具。在这一领域,谷歌浏览器凭借其强大的性能与丰富的扩展功能,提供了多种在线会议解决方案,满足用户的不同需求。 首先,谷歌自身的“谷
时间:2024-12-26
 如何定制谷歌浏览器的启动页

如何定制谷歌浏览器的启动页

如何定制谷歌浏览器的启动页 在如今这个信息化、数字化的时代,网络浏览已经成为人们日常生活中不可或缺的一部分。作为全球使用最广泛的浏览器之一,谷歌浏览器(Google Chrome)凭借其简单的界面和强
时间:2024-12-26
 谷歌浏览器的密码生成器使用指南

谷歌浏览器的密码生成器使用指南

随着网络安全的重要性日益增强,保护个人信息和账户安全成为每个互联网用户的基本需求。密码管理工具和自动生成强密码的功能在此背景下应运而生。谷歌浏览器自带的密码生成器就是一个实用的功能,可以帮助用户轻松创
时间:2024-12-26
 用谷歌浏览器高效工作的方法分享

用谷歌浏览器高效工作的方法分享

在当今的数字时代,浏览器已经成为我们工作和生活中不可或缺的工具。而谷歌浏览器(Google Chrome)凭借其快速、安全和可扩展性,成为了许多专业人士的首选。在这篇文章中,我们将分享一些在谷歌浏览器
时间:2024-12-26
 如何在谷歌浏览器中保护儿童上网安全

如何在谷歌浏览器中保护儿童上网安全

如何在谷歌浏览器中保护儿童上网安全 随着互联网的迅猛发展,儿童的上网时间越来越多,如何确保他们在网络世界中的安全成为家长们关注的重点。谷歌浏览器(Chrome)作为全球使用最广泛的浏览器之一,提供了多
时间:2024-12-26
 如何通过谷歌浏览器追踪包裹

如何通过谷歌浏览器追踪包裹

在现代电子商务的快速发展中,包裹追踪已成为购物体验中不可或缺的一部分。无论是购买的衣物、电子产品,还是生活用品,消费者对包裹的运送进度充满期待。而通过谷歌浏览器追踪包裹则是一种简单高效的方式,本文将为
时间:2024-12-26
 谷歌浏览器的在线音乐播放技巧

谷歌浏览器的在线音乐播放技巧

谷歌浏览器的在线音乐播放技巧 随着互联网的发展,在线音乐服务已经成为人们日常生活中不可或缺的一部分。在这个信息丰富的时代,谷歌浏览器作为一个强大的工具,能够为我们提供更好的在线音乐播放体验。本文将为您
时间:2024-12-26
 如何在谷歌浏览器中使用云服务

如何在谷歌浏览器中使用云服务

在现代数字化时代,云服务已经遍及我们生活的方方面面,越来越多的人依赖它们来存储数据、进行备份、协作和共享文件。谷歌浏览器作为一种流行的网络浏览器,具备强大的扩展功能和易用性,使用户能够轻松访问多种云服
时间:2024-12-26
 谷歌浏览器中的无障碍功能介绍

谷歌浏览器中的无障碍功能介绍

谷歌浏览器中的无障碍功能介绍 随着互联网的普及,越来越多的人依赖网络获取信息和进行日常交流。然而,许多用户可能因为身体障碍或特定需求而面临网页访问的困难。为了解决这一问题,谷歌浏览器(Google C
时间:2024-12-26
 谷歌浏览器的购物插件推荐

谷歌浏览器的购物插件推荐

随着在线购物日益受到欢迎,越来越多的用户开始寻找更加便捷的购物方式。在这方面,谷歌浏览器的购物插件可以大大提升购物体验,不仅能帮助用户找到更好的优惠,还能简化购物流程。以下是一些值得推荐的谷歌浏览器购
时间:2024-12-26
返回顶部